We sit down with Dr. Zakaria to unpack how mobility is transforming the automotive business far beyond EV hype. From dealership floors to data platforms, we trace the shift from one-time sales to lifetime relationships where software, service, and trust define winners.
We get practical about market readiness: when EVs make sense, where hybrids lead, and why charging reliability, financing, and skilled technicians drive adoption more than press releases. Dr. Zakaria shares a candid view from inside the industry, balancing luxury, premium, and mainstream lineups; running dual tracks for EV and hybrid; and deciding when local manufacturing beats imports. We talk total cost of ownership, lease-to-own models, and the role of cybersecurity now that cars are rolling computers. If you care about safety, performance parity, and battery lifecycles, this conversation brings clarity without the buzzwords.
Leadership and culture make or break the transition. We compare gut vs data when decisions are urgent, show how to run clean budgeting and high-candor feedback, and outline weekly strategy rhythms that keep teams aligned without drama. The throughline is simple: behavior change sticks when communication is consistent, rituals are clear, and adoption includes everyone—from executives to technicians.
